Canon Pixma MP560 Series K10343 Specification

The Canon Pixma MP560 Series K10343 is a versatile all-in-one inkjet printer designed for both home and small office environments. It offers high-quality printing, scanning, and copying capabilities. The printer delivers a maximum color print resolution of up to 9600 x 2400 dpi, ensuring detailed and vibrant image reproduction. It utilizes a five-color ink system, which includes a pigment-based black ink for sharp text and dye-based inks for rich photos. The MP560 features built-in wireless connectivity, allowing users to print from multiple devices without the need for wired connections, enhancing convenience and flexibility.

The printer is equipped with a 2.0-inch LCD screen, facilitating easy navigation and operation. It supports automatic duplex printing, reducing paper usage by enabling double-sided printing. The device also includes a multi-card reader, providing direct printing from compatible memory cards without the need for a PC. The scanner function offers an optical resolution of 2400 x 4800 dpi, ensuring high-quality scans suitable for both documents and photos. With its compact design, the Canon Pixma MP560 fits seamlessly into various workspaces, and its quiet mode minimizes noise disruptions during operation.

The printer is compatible with various operating systems, including Windows and macOS, and supports PictBridge for direct photo printing from compatible cameras. Energy-efficient features, such as automatic power on/off, contribute to reduced energy consumption. Canon Pixma MP560 Series K10343 F.A.Q.

How do I connect my Canon Pixma MP560 printer to a wireless network?

To connect your Canon Pixma MP560 to a wireless network, press the 'Menu' button on the printer, navigate to 'Settings', and select 'Wireless LAN setup'. Follow the on-screen instructions to select your network and enter your Wi-Fi password.

What should I do if my Canon Pixma MP560 is not printing?

First, check if the printer is turned on and connected to the same network as your computer. Verify that there are no error messages or flashing lights on the printer. Ensure that the ink cartridges and paper are correctly installed. Additionally, check the printer queue for any paused jobs.

How can I clean the print head on my Canon Pixma MP560?

To clean the print head, access the printer's maintenance settings from the menu, and select 'Cleaning' or 'Deep Cleaning'. Follow the prompts to initiate the cleaning process, which may take a few minutes to complete.

Why is my Canon Pixma MP560 printing blank pages?

Blank pages can result from empty ink cartridges, clogged print heads, or incorrect paper settings. Check the ink levels and replace any empty cartridges. Clean the print head if necessary, and ensure that the paper settings in the printer driver match the paper loaded in the printer.

How do I replace the ink cartridges in my Canon Pixma MP560?

Open the printer cover to access the ink cartridge holder. Press down on the empty cartridge to release it, then remove it from the holder. Unpack the new cartridge, remove protective tapes, and insert it into the holder until it clicks into place. Close the printer cover.

What type of paper should I use for best print quality on the Canon Pixma MP560?

For optimal print quality, use Canon's recommended photo paper, such as Canon Photo Paper Plus Glossy II or Canon Matte Photo Paper. Ensure that the paper type setting in the printer driver matches the paper you are using.

How do I perform a factory reset on the Canon Pixma MP560?

To perform a factory reset, press the 'Menu' button, navigate to 'Settings', and select 'Device settings'. Choose 'Reset setting', then 'Reset all', and confirm the selection. The printer will restart with factory settings.

Can I use third-party ink cartridges with the Canon Pixma MP560?

While it is possible to use third-party ink cartridges, Canon recommends using genuine Canon ink for best performance and print quality. Third-party cartridges may not provide the same reliability and could potentially damage the printer.

How do I scan a document using the Canon Pixma MP560?

Place the document on the scanner glass, then press the 'Scan' button on the printer. Choose the type of scan you want to perform, such as 'Scan to PC', and follow the on-screen instructions to complete the scan and save it to your computer.

What should I do if paper jams occur frequently in my Canon Pixma MP560?

Ensure that the paper is loaded correctly and not exceeding the maximum capacity of the paper tray. Check for any obstructions in the paper path, and use only the recommended paper types and sizes. Regularly clean the paper feed rollers to prevent jams.
